Leptin
A hormone that affects appetite and is believed to affect the onset of puberty. Leptin levels increase during childhood and peak at around age 12.
Estrogen
A group of steroid hormones that play a key role in the development and regulation of the female reproductive system and secondary sex characteristics.
Cortisol
The primary stress hormone; fluctuations in the body’s cortisol level affect human emotions.
Lipid
A class of organic compounds that are fatty acids or their derivatives and are insoluble in water but soluble in organic solvents. They are used by the body for energy storage and structural functions.
